Progress in characterizing the linkage between Fusobacterium nucleatum and gastrointestinal cancer.

Yang Liu1,2, Yoshifumi Baba1, Takatsugu Ishimoto1,3, Masaaki Iwatsuki1, Yukiharu Hiyoshi1, Yuji Miyamoto1, Naoya Yoshida1, Rong Wu2, Hideo Baba4.   

Abstract

Microbiome research is a rapidly advancing field in human cancers. Fusobacterium nucleatum is an oral bacterium, indigenous to the human oral cavity, that plays a role in periodontal disease. Recent studies have found that F. nucleatum can promote gastrointestinal tumor progression and affect the prognosis of the disease. In addition, F. nucleatum may contribute to the chemo-resistance of gastrointestinal cancers. This review summarizes recent progress in the pathogenesis of F. nucleatum and its impact on gastrointestinal cancer.
